Eya recolamus. Anonymous. A cappella. Sacred , Sequence hymn for the 2nd Mass of Christmas. Language. Latin. SAA.

“In Nativitate Domini in aurora sequentia” transcribed from the Trent manuscript tr93. The time signature and the notes' values are as in the manuscript. The traditional melody. Graduale Pataviense c. 195r. is paraphrased at the Superius. The missing 3rd verse of the Contra has been derived from the Superius using the “faulxbourdon” technique. The notes' values within the "ligaturæ" are as follows. the left upstemmed notes are semibreves - the unstemmed note is a brevis - the right downstemmed note is a longa. The "musica ficta" suggestions are in the MIDI and MusicXML files.
